On Thu, 29 May 2003, Sylvain Petreolle wrote:

> One problem with setup.exe :
> why are always test packages automatically downgraded to the stable
> releases when installing other packages ?
>
> I installed the "file" package after installing the Xfree86-xserv
> 4.2.0.38, setup downgraded it to 4.2.0.37.
>
> Sylvain Petreolle

Sylvain,

This issue has been discussed on the cygwin-apps mailing list before.
Unfortunately, none of the setup developers currently have the time or the
motivation to work on this feature.  As always, patches thoughtfully
considered, and, for the most part, gratefully accepted...

For the setup developers: this issue is similar, but not the same as the
"always-keep" packages that were discussed as well.  It makes much more
sense to not downgrade a test package if a person chose to install it than
it does to not upgrade some other random package.  The logic seems simpler
too.  If nobody gets to this in a couple of weeks, I'll see if I can come
up with a patch.
